Montgomery County Police arrested a Burtonsville man this week, accusing him of hiring a gunman who fatally shot a Silver Spring man in 2025.

Bekine Tibebu Ayele, 23, is charged with first-degree murder in connection with the homicide of Jonah Kimindu Mutua, 23, who was found shot on March 8 last year, according to a statement from police.

Officers on that date responded to the 2700 block of Fairdale Terrace for a report of a shooting and found Mutua in a parking lot.

Homicide detectives identified 23-year-old Douglas David Lacey as the shooter and arrested him in April 2025. He remains in custody under indictment for Mutua’s death.

As the investigation continued, detectives discovered evidence showing that Ayele hired Lacey to kill Mutua, police said.

Ayele is being held at the Montgomery County Central Processing Unit, where he awaits a bond hearing.

It was unclear Tuesday morning whether Ayele had retained an attorney.
